Alicia Vikander Shares Rare Insight into Raising Son With Husband Michael Fassbender
View
Date:2025-04-15 10:23:37
Parenthood changed everything for Alicia Vikander.
The Firebrand actress offered rare insight into her life as mom to her and husband Michael Fassbender's 3-year-old son.
"Becoming a parent changes you in a second, when the child arrives," Vikander exclusively told E! News' Francesca Amiker. "I, for sure, now have a lot more insight and especially all the worries."
The actress continued, "I think it also gives you extra strength because it's like it's beyond you. It's not just you or survival. You need to stay alive to make sure that you can take care of these young children."
The Tomb Raider star, 35, and Fassbender, 47, met in 2014 on the set of the movie The Light Between Oceans. After keeping their engagement private, the actors married in Ibiza in 2017.
In 2021, Vikander revealed that she and Fassbender welcomed their first baby, whose name has not been made public. "I now have a whole new understanding of life in general," she told People at the time. "That's pretty beautiful and obviously will give a lot to any of my work in the future."
The following year, Vikander gave more insight into her motherhood experience while also revealing that her and Fassbender's child is a boy. "He's learning to walk," she told Harper's Bazaar UK. "So, it's good there's carpet everywhere."
She also spoke about how she and Fassbender always travel together with their son. "That's the rule," she said. "We do jobs so one of us can always be with the baby."
Roadside Attractions is set to release Vikander's latest film Firebrand in theaters nationally June 14.

Back in November 2014, a source told E! News exclusively that the lovebirds were "casually dating." Around that time, the actors were spotted catching some waves together at Bondi Beach in Sydney.
Alicia and Michael met on the set of The Light Between Oceans, a psychological drama that finally received its September 2016 release date two years after filming wrapped.
Notoriously tight-lipped when it comes to their relationship, the duo proved they were still going strong when they attended the 2015 Infiniti Red Bull Racing Energy Station in Monte Carlo together.
Jet-setters! Fans of the longtime couple couldn't help but gush over Michael and Alicia's relationship taking a seemingly serious turn.
The Tomb Raider star kicked off the 2016 awards season by stepping out for dinner with her leading man ahead of the BAFTAs in London.
These two couldn't keep their eyes of each other while spotted at the 2016 Venice Film Festival.
In The Light Between Oceans, the real-life couple play childless spouses who raise a baby they've rescue from a rowboat as their own. Naturally, complications ensue.
While promoting their latest film, the stars stepped out at the Venice Film Festival in September 2016 looking every inch joyously in love.
Alicia and Michael were all smiles as they walked the 2016 Venice Film Festival red carpet together with their arms around each other.
